PowerPoint now has a translation tool

PowerPoint now has a plugin that allows you to translate right in the slide show. This tool uses Microsoft Translation API to translate content in 10 languages: Arabic, Chinese, English, French, German, Italian, Japanese, Russian and Spanish . Moreover, the plugin also creates annotations in languages ​​suitable for those who have difficulty hearing.

With 100 million Office 365 users worldwide, this translation tool will be very welcome. PowerPoint is the most popular application for creating a slideshow, so creating a slide in English and not having to translate it, can be used immediately in Beijing that has never been heard.

Cortana Skils Kit officially released Public Preview in the US

After the promise from September, Microsoft today officially allowed developers to create new skills for Cortana. Developers can build skills for Cortana by creating bots and publishing on Cortana's own channel using Microsoft Bot Framework or reusing the code used to create Alexa. According to Harman Kardon Invoke, it is available on all Windows 10 devices, Android, iOS and devices with new Cortana integration. With 141 million Cortana users, developers will be motivated to create new features for her AI assistant.

Release Visual Studio for macOS

After the promise in November, today Microsoft officially announced Visual Studio has released to the public (previously Preview version). This is important because it is a sign of Microsoft 's vision of supporting developers, no matter where they write the code. Before that was the Linux terminal version on Windows released last year.

Visual Studio is a popular IDE, although often used for Windows applications, it still makes great strides when working on mobile (along with Xamarin) and now computer platforms like macOS and Linux.

Azure moves to a mobile device

Program director Scott Hanselman announced important updates to the cloud computing platform. One of the most interesting things is the introduction of two mobile apps for iOS and Andoird , helping users manage applications using Azure. Not really that you can work on a mobile application, but you can check your analytics in real time, view error reports, restart virtual machines . to work more conveniently.

Build AI models in minutes

No doubt the AI ​​will still stir the technology industry for the next few years. And one of the remarkable tools is Cognitive Services. Usually it takes several days (sometimes weeks or months) to teach AI to do simple tasks. Today, Microsoft unveiled Custom Vision, a tool that enables the creation of complex computer vision applications very quickly. Creating visual API models now requires only a few sample data to teach the model. This will significantly increase the development process.

Here are a few other remarkable things

  1. Azure Batch AI Training releases Private Preview that allows running models with multiple CPUs and GPUs.
  2. Microsoft officially owns the most identifiable services with 29, in addition to Custom Vision, there are new services like Bing Custom Search, Custom Decision Service and Video Indexer.
  3. The Microsoft Graph API allows developers to access data 365 and connect more easily, including APIs from SharePoint and Planner.
  4. Any developer can publish on Microsoft Teams.
  5. The new Project Emma project explores the use of sensors and AI to detect and monitor complex symptoms of diseases.
  6. New MySQL and PostgreSQL management services will work with Azure SQL Database to bring developers more options and flexibility.
  7. Publish Azure Cosmos DB.
  8. Introducing Azure IoT Edge.
